Brad Pitt & Angelina Jolie Reach Divorce Settlement After 8-Year Battle
Brad Pitt and Angelina Jolie have finally reached a divorce settlement after more than eight years of legal battles.
The ex-couple finalized their divorce on Dec. 30, 2024, with Jolie’s lawyer, James Simon, telling PEOPLE, “This is just one part of a long ongoing process that started eight years ago. Frankly, Angelina is exhausted, but she is relieved this one part is over.”
Jolie filed for divorce in 2016 after an incident on a private plane where she claimed Pitt was abusive.
In 2017, they agreed to resolve their issues through a private judge, and they were legally declared single in 2019. However, battles over custody and their $164 million French estate, Château Miraval, continued until now.
While the details of their settlement remain unknown, both Pitt and Jolie are focused on their family as they share six children together.
